Cheng Zhao
|
d8c05ecc0d
|
Link with Vs2015 runtime statically for Release build
|
2016-05-19 15:06:47 +09:00 |
|
Nicola Squartini
|
18b2094198
|
Update Clang only if needed
|
2016-05-19 10:14:57 +09:00 |
|
Cheng Zhao
|
ba7a32b16e
|
Sync submodule recursively
|
2016-05-15 10:33:23 +09:00 |
|
Cheng Zhao
|
800ab50b56
|
Download redist files of VS2015
|
2016-05-15 10:30:19 +09:00 |
|
Cheng Zhao
|
3214fdd73f
|
Fix failing CI on OS X
|
2016-05-14 23:11:13 +09:00 |
|
Cheng Zhao
|
29b799de73
|
Update clang revision to 261368
|
2016-05-13 11:18:16 +09:00 |
|
Cheng Zhao
|
8dc8f8f485
|
Update libchromiumcontent: fix Release build on Windows
|
2016-05-13 11:12:01 +09:00 |
|
Cheng Zhao
|
4a409b870e
|
chromedriver's version is now v2.21
|
2016-05-13 11:12:01 +09:00 |
|
Cheng Zhao
|
3aaff23f78
|
Do not call import_vs_env for non-win32
|
2016-05-13 11:12:01 +09:00 |
|
Cheng Zhao
|
2497c73009
|
Import build env from VS 2015
|
2016-05-13 11:12:01 +09:00 |
|
Cheng Zhao
|
9c0f298064
|
Update libchromiumcontent to fix renderer process crash
|
2016-05-13 11:12:01 +09:00 |
|
Brian R. Bondy
|
a9652052c4
|
Update Brightray and libchromiumcontent v50 ref (Electron maintainer use
your refs)
|
2016-05-13 11:11:50 +09:00 |
|
Cheng Zhao
|
67a768fc77
|
Do not download clang on Windows
|
2016-05-03 09:38:15 +09:00 |
|
Cheng Zhao
|
49eed1ebb9
|
Ignore CC and CXX if user didn't change build configuration
|
2016-05-03 09:31:39 +09:00 |
|
Cheng Zhao
|
ac3a704abc
|
Avoid overriding environment variables
|
2016-05-02 12:38:17 +00:00 |
|
Cheng Zhao
|
34b4ebd9f3
|
Fix logic errors
|
2016-05-02 12:15:10 +00:00 |
|
Cheng Zhao
|
098d72b741
|
Convert --clang_dir and --disable_clang to --defines
|
2016-05-02 21:19:16 +09:00 |
|
Cheng Zhao
|
26e4ce30bb
|
Pass --disable_clang and --clang_dir to libchromiumcontent
|
2016-05-02 20:06:21 +09:00 |
|
Cheng Zhao
|
bd70d9008f
|
Update modules before calling build_libchromiumcontent
|
2016-05-02 07:45:48 +00:00 |
|
Cheng Zhao
|
cc24bea813
|
Fix pylint warnings
|
2016-05-02 16:38:58 +09:00 |
|
Cheng Zhao
|
26c0ad1c2f
|
Add --build_libchromiumcontent option
|
2016-05-02 16:17:38 +09:00 |
|
Cheng Zhao
|
47f7f7b02e
|
Revert "Don't upload PDB files in CI"
This reverts commit 7ab8134613 .
|
2016-04-30 21:43:33 +09:00 |
|
Cheng Zhao
|
2a55d93501
|
Remove the output file after testing
|
2016-04-30 17:52:53 +09:00 |
|
Cheng Zhao
|
b68a25835f
|
Make sure output is written when test fails
|
2016-04-30 17:48:07 +09:00 |
|
Cheng Zhao
|
3dcf69eab3
|
Also run tests on 32bit Windows
|
2016-04-30 17:17:23 +09:00 |
|
Cheng Zhao
|
8aa88067ca
|
Do not write to stdout in Electron when running on win32 CI machine
This makes Electron crash on CI machine somehow.
|
2016-04-30 17:08:51 +09:00 |
|
Cheng Zhao
|
6756f8c7af
|
Make win32 CI machine run tests
|
2016-04-30 15:38:23 +09:00 |
|
Cheng Zhao
|
f3c3042deb
|
Do not run clean in cibuild
|
2016-04-27 19:55:01 +09:00 |
|
Cheng Zhao
|
7d4e0629d6
|
Fix the link error
|
2016-04-14 18:22:29 +09:00 |
|
Cheng Zhao
|
b9ad09db91
|
Update libchromiumcontent with necessary headers and libs
|
2016-04-14 17:14:45 +09:00 |
|
Cheng Zhao
|
d703a87317
|
Update libchromiumcontent with disable_hidden.patch
|
2016-04-08 15:22:57 +09:00 |
|
Kevin Sawicki
|
4041d52864
|
Use single quotes
|
2016-04-07 10:15:31 -07:00 |
|
Kevin Sawicki
|
10860e4ec5
|
Use npm.cmd on Windows to print version
|
2016-04-07 10:14:52 -07:00 |
|
Kevin Sawicki
|
687a512b11
|
Log node and npm versions
|
2016-04-07 10:03:16 -07:00 |
|
Kevin Sawicki
|
e95224deab
|
Remove +=
|
2016-04-07 10:00:23 -07:00 |
|
Kevin Sawicki
|
a74b9607b6
|
Add more logging
|
2016-04-07 09:59:46 -07:00 |
|
Kevin Sawicki
|
0fad8fdc4b
|
Add missing .path
|
2016-04-07 09:56:04 -07:00 |
|
Kevin Sawicki
|
7e87973d60
|
Log version to verify
|
2016-04-07 09:55:23 -07:00 |
|
Kevin Sawicki
|
d3308cf8c3
|
Use node 0.10.21 on CI
|
2016-04-07 09:53:33 -07:00 |
|
Cheng Zhao
|
71b67534a8
|
Fix coding styles
|
2016-04-07 15:45:20 +09:00 |
|
Paul Betts
|
3ee366257c
|
Allow bootstrap to be invoked via python2
This means that on most Linux distributions where python3 is the default, we
can invoke `python2 script/bootstrap.py` and have it all work
|
2016-04-07 15:43:57 +09:00 |
|
Cheng Zhao
|
b4885b9a37
|
atom => electron in upload script
|
2016-04-07 10:34:25 +09:00 |
|
Cheng Zhao
|
4a724e91e0
|
Update libchromiumcontent: remove white background on OS X
|
2016-04-03 11:17:57 +09:00 |
|
Kevin Sawicki
|
c036986cc4
|
atom.gyp -> electron.gyp
|
2016-04-01 16:11:40 -07:00 |
|
deepak1556
|
7e366dd5c8
|
Update libchromiumcontent
|
2016-04-01 08:14:29 +05:30 |
|
Zeke Sikelianos
|
aadc0bee25
|
do not lint on windows CI
|
2016-03-30 17:00:34 -07:00 |
|
Zeke Sikelianos
|
0d11b755db
|
say we are linting
|
2016-03-30 17:00:34 -07:00 |
|
Zeke Sikelianos
|
afbc914f8b
|
try to fix CI linting
|
2016-03-30 17:00:34 -07:00 |
|
Zeke Sikelianos
|
e156faea5c
|
replace eslint with standard
|
2016-03-30 17:00:33 -07:00 |
|
Cheng Zhao
|
0f620a5393
|
Do not copy system libraries on Linux
|
2016-03-11 22:29:03 +09:00 |
|
Cheng Zhao
|
5f63df248a
|
Fix the chrome version
|
2016-03-11 19:53:41 +09:00 |
|
Robo
|
ed2103a49f
|
update sysroot image revisions
|
2016-03-10 17:34:42 +05:30 |
|
Robo
|
91951472bf
|
use sysroot by default on linux
|
2016-03-10 17:34:42 +05:30 |
|
Robo
|
e27e3d641c
|
linux: optionaly allow building x64 targets with sysroot
|
2016-03-10 17:34:42 +05:30 |
|
Cheng Zhao
|
0794980d01
|
pdf.dll is not shipped any more
|
2016-03-10 17:36:11 +09:00 |
|
Cheng Zhao
|
cadd1969d9
|
Fix compilation errors on Windows
|
2016-03-10 17:06:23 +09:00 |
|
Cheng Zhao
|
9bc9a1a2bd
|
Upgrade to Chrome 49
|
2016-03-10 17:06:20 +09:00 |
|
Kevin Sawicki
|
4c9f5b71f7
|
Run eslint over lib folder
|
2016-03-08 11:14:22 -08:00 |
|
Cheng Zhao
|
8a744255fa
|
Update libchromiumcontent, use harfbuzz 1.06
Close #4513.
|
2016-02-26 09:23:39 +08:00 |
|
Cheng Zhao
|
daffb4881e
|
Create and upload free version of ffmpeg
|
2016-02-19 12:06:48 +08:00 |
|
Cheng Zhao
|
cd30308711
|
Update libchromiumcontent with free version of ffmpeg
|
2016-02-19 12:06:48 +08:00 |
|
Cheng Zhao
|
35815387ab
|
Ship ffmpeg in dist, close #4536
|
2016-02-18 18:57:31 +08:00 |
|
Cheng Zhao
|
1e894df102
|
Update libchromiumcontent, fix #3666
|
2016-02-18 12:14:25 +08:00 |
|
Cheng Zhao
|
3d3fc18a3a
|
Update libchromiumcontent to use shared ffmpeg
|
2016-02-17 23:23:36 +08:00 |
|
Cheng Zhao
|
01ede11cb8
|
Skip eslint on our Windows build machine for now
|
2016-02-17 10:54:44 +08:00 |
|
Robo
|
a6bcc5d110
|
common: export hideInternalModules
|
2016-01-27 18:44:47 +05:30 |
|
Kevin Sawicki
|
3a55647ae3
|
Add WebView to globals
|
2016-01-21 09:32:22 -07:00 |
|
Kevin Sawicki
|
b46d8ec91b
|
Enable no-undef eslint rule
|
2016-01-21 09:32:22 -07:00 |
|
Kevin Sawicki
|
b5cf352312
|
Add globals to eslint config
|
2016-01-21 09:32:22 -07:00 |
|
Kevin Sawicki
|
b1f679ff6d
|
Clean up semicolon lint errors
|
2016-01-21 09:32:21 -07:00 |
|
Kevin Sawicki
|
70bcb0ac5a
|
Clean up no-unused-vars lint errors
|
2016-01-21 09:32:21 -07:00 |
|
Kevin Sawicki
|
ccce284a5b
|
Clean up no-empty lint errors
|
2016-01-21 09:32:21 -07:00 |
|
Kevin Sawicki
|
4f4456bde8
|
Clean up indent eslint errors
|
2016-01-21 09:32:21 -07:00 |
|
Kevin Sawicki
|
45ddbb6d67
|
Clean up no-unreachable lint errors
|
2016-01-21 09:32:21 -07:00 |
|
Kevin Sawicki
|
5d249e2a94
|
Run cpplint on utility folder
|
2016-01-20 09:43:32 -07:00 |
|
Kevin Sawicki
|
4e183df997
|
Add npm start script
|
2016-01-16 12:31:09 -08:00 |
|
Kevin Sawicki
|
503cd04c75
|
Disable linebreak-style rule
|
2016-01-15 14:58:46 -08:00 |
|
Kevin Sawicki
|
da120d8874
|
Lint entire atom folder
|
2016-01-15 14:43:23 -08:00 |
|
Kevin Sawicki
|
2869869a99
|
Combine duplicate eslint keys
|
2016-01-15 14:40:37 -08:00 |
|
Kevin Sawicki
|
1d3e7dc6e4
|
Run eslint on CI
|
2016-01-15 14:38:07 -08:00 |
|
Kevin Sawicki
|
b87599a6a2
|
Rename eslintrc-src to eslintrc-base
|
2016-01-15 14:37:51 -08:00 |
|
Kevin Sawicki
|
756f8039e5
|
Lint spec js files
|
2016-01-15 14:02:05 -08:00 |
|
Kevin Sawicki
|
4db4d409a7
|
Add initial eslint script
|
2016-01-15 13:52:18 -08:00 |
|
Kevin Sawicki
|
714e544b51
|
Remove coffeelint usage
|
2016-01-12 16:24:06 -08:00 |
|
Cheng Zhao
|
554575b029
|
Upgrade to Chrome 47.0.2526.110
|
2016-01-12 20:46:47 +08:00 |
|
Cheng Zhao
|
1de9cfd4eb
|
Backport https://codereview.chromium.org/1500713003
|
2016-01-11 12:59:02 +08:00 |
|
Cheng Zhao
|
cf09e7cb51
|
Update libchromiumcontent for #3958
|
2016-01-04 10:59:52 +08:00 |
|
Cheng Zhao
|
b3832629a2
|
Update libchromiumcontent: component_updater is not needed
|
2015-12-30 16:14:50 +08:00 |
|
Cheng Zhao
|
c5238bb8f0
|
Update brightray and libchromiumcontent with widevine support
|
2015-12-30 11:45:39 +08:00 |
|
Cheng Zhao
|
c47aebaeb4
|
Do not ship widevine plugin
|
2015-12-29 21:38:01 +08:00 |
|
Cheng Zhao
|
8ca1bea58b
|
Do not link with unnecessary libraries
|
2015-12-29 15:45:34 +08:00 |
|
Cheng Zhao
|
19ab68abfb
|
Update libchromiumcontent to include widevine libraries
|
2015-12-29 14:51:00 +08:00 |
|
Cheng Zhao
|
8b88c99685
|
No longer need to ship with libnotify.so
|
2015-12-24 11:17:32 +08:00 |
|
Cheng Zhao
|
c7bfd5f09d
|
Upgrade libchromiumcontent: enable sending sync message to UI thread
|
2015-12-17 20:12:05 +08:00 |
|
Cheng Zhao
|
a29abf1e34
|
Update libchromiumcontent
Remove usages of private xpc_ APIs, fix #3823.
|
2015-12-16 18:06:47 +08:00 |
|
Sean Francis N. Ballais
|
2d2ad0d33b
|
Addeda versionin package.json.
|
2015-12-14 18:17:04 +08:00 |
|
Cheng Zhao
|
0df9eeb2dd
|
Backport https://codereview.chromium.org/1406133003
|
2015-12-12 22:16:28 +08:00 |
|
Cheng Zhao
|
d2e63dfc64
|
Use HTTPS for libchromiumcontent's URL
Without using the subdomain we should be able to work around the domain
license problem of python.
|
2015-12-09 18:14:37 +08:00 |
|
Cheng Zhao
|
505193e239
|
Link with libyuv_neon.a on ARM
|
2015-12-08 18:15:01 +08:00 |
|
Cheng Zhao
|
9daeafbace
|
Install libxtst-dev on travis ci
|
2015-12-08 17:32:42 +08:00 |
|